#942c51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#942c51 is composed of 58% red, 17.3%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.3% magenta, 45.3%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 338.7 degrees, a saturation of 54.2% and a lightness of 37.6%. #942c51 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ff58a2 with #290000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#942c51
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0407 is the darkest color, while #fefc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#942c51
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606060 is the less saturated color, while #b90746 is the most saturated one.
